DOW vs SCCO: Which Is the Better Dividend Stock?
As of July 2026, SCCO (Southern Copper Corporation) screens as the stronger dividend stock, winning 6 of 7 head-to-head metrics. DOW offers the higher yield at 4.68%, SCCO has the higher dividend-safety score.
| Metric | DOW | SCCO |
|---|---|---|
| Forward yield | 4.68% | 2.32% |
| Annual dividend | $1.40 | $4.00 |
| Payout ratio | 700% | 56% |
| Years of growth | 0 yr | 1 yr |
| 5-yr dividend growth | -5.6% | 16.0% |
| 5-yr total return | -52% | 191% |
| Dividend safety score | 45 (D) | 56 (C) |
| Fair value estimate | $58.66 | — |
| Upside to fair value | +96% | — |
| Frequency | quarterly | quarterly |
| Market cap | $21.9B | $146.1B |
| P/E ratio | — | 29.2 |
